AHA guide offers insights, recommendations on navigating workforce challenges

The AHA Nov. 13 released its 2025 Health Care Workforce Scan — an annual snapshot of America’s hospital and health system employment, based on reports, studies and other data sources from leading organizations and researchers. It also offers insights and recommendations from peers and experts. Download the 2025 Health Care Workforce Scan to learn more about the four core challenges identified.
